Darwin's fox vs fig wax scale

Lycalopex fulvipes compared with Ceroplastes japonicus

Key Differences

  • Darwin's fox is Endangered while fig wax scale is Not Evaluated.

Taxonomic Classification

Rank Darwin's fox fig wax scale
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Arthropoda (Arthropods)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Insecta (Insects)
Order Carnivora (Carnivorans) Hemiptera (Hemiptera)
Family Canidae (Dogs & Wolves) Coccidae
Genus Lycalopex Ceroplastes
Species Lycalopex fulvipes Ceroplastes japonicus

Evolutionary Relationship

Darwin's fox and fig wax scale share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
